Former LSU LB Devin White signs with Texans

10/23/2024
Untitled Design 2024 10 23t094223.379

Devin White has signed with the Houston Texans, the team announced Wednesday morning.

The former Pro Bowler signed a one-year deal with the Philadelphia Eagles this offseason, but never played a snap with the team. He was released on October 8.

His sharp decline has been a curious one. White was the fifth overall selection in the 2019 draft by Tampa Bay. He was second-team All Pro for the Super Bowl champion Buccaneers in 2020 and a Pro Bowler in 2021. White and the Bucs could not come to terms on a contract extension, so he requested a trade during the 2023 offseason. The team released him before he eventually signed with the Eagles.

In Houston, he will play for former All Pro linebacker DeMeco Ryans. The Texans are 5-2 and currently in first place in the AFC South.
